构建高性能微服务架构:后端开发的现代实践
随着云计算和DevOps文化的兴起,微服务架构已成为许多组织转型的首选模式。这种架构风格支持将应用程序分解为一组小型、松耦合的服务,每个服务围绕特定的业务能力构建,并独立部署在其自己的进程中。然而,为了确保这种架构能够提供高性能和高可用性,开发者必须遵循一些关键原则和技术实践。 首先,理解微服务设计原则至关重要。...
构建未来:云原生架构在企业数字化转型中的关键作用
在当今的商业环境中,企业正面临着前所未有的挑战和机遇。客户需求的不断变化、市场竞争的加剧以及对创新的不断追求,促使企业必须加快其数字化转型的步伐。在这一过程中,云原生架构以其独特的优势,成为了企业转型的重要支撑。 云原生架构是一种构建和运行应用程序的方法,它利用了云计算的弹性、可扩展性和自动化特点。这种架构的核心在于将应用程序...
构建高效可扩展的微服务架构:后端工程师的挑战与机遇
在当今快速变化的商业环境中,软件系统需要能够迅速适应不断变化的市场需求。微服务架构以其灵活性和可扩展性,为后端工程师提供了解决复杂问题的新途径。然而,这种架构风格也带来了一系列独特的挑战。 首先,我们来定义什么是微服务。简而言之,微服务是一种架构风格,它提倡将单一应用程序分解为一组小的、松散耦合的服务...
构建未来:云原生架构在现代企业中的应用与挑战
在当今的商业环境中,企业必须快速适应不断变化的市场需求和技术进步。云原生架构,作为支持这种适应性的重要工具,提供了一种全新的方法来构建、部署和管理应用程序它利用云计算的优势,实现了资源的弹性伸缩、服务的微服务化和自动化运维。 核心组件包括容器化技术如Docker,用于打包应用及其依赖;微服务架构,将...
构建高效微服务架构:从理论到实践
随着业务的不断扩张和技术的日新月异,传统的单体应用架构已难以满足现代业务的发展需求。微服务架构应运而生,它通过将复杂的单体应用拆分成一系列小型、独立的服务来提升系统的可管理性和可扩展性。然而,构建一个高效的微服务系统并非易事,它需要开发者具备跨领域的知识和严谨的实践经验。 首先,理解微服务的核心概念至关重要。微服务架构强调的是...
构建高效安卓应用:Jetpack MVVM 架构的实践之路
随着智能手机的普及,Android 应用的开发愈发显得重要。为了适应市场的需求,应用需要快速迭代更新,同时保持高质量的用户体验。近年来,Jetpack 组件库以及其推荐的 MVVM (Model-View-ViewModel) 架构模式成为了 Android 开发的主流趋势。接下来,让我们深入了解这一架构模式的优势及其在 An...
构建高效微服务架构:从理论到实践
微服务架构是一种将应用程序作为一系列小型服务开发的方法,每个服务运行在其独立的进程中,并通过轻量级的通信机制相互协作。这种架构风格促进了敏捷开发、部署和扩展,同时提高了系统的弹性和容错能力。然而,微服务的实施并非没有挑战,它要求开发者对系统的设计和运维有深入的理解。 首先,微服务的拆分是构建微服务架构的基础。正确...
构建未来:云原生架构在现代业务中的应用
在当今的商业环境中,组织必须不断适应快速变化的市场需求和技术创新。为了保持竞争力,企业正转向云计算,寻求更加灵活和高效的运营模式。云原生架构,作为一种利用云计算优势进行设计和应用部署的方法,已经成为推动业务和技术融合的重要力量。 云原生的核心是构建和运行可在公共云、私有云和混合云环境中扩展的应用程序。这涉及到一系列最佳实践和模...
构建高效微服务架构的五大关键策略
随着企业对软件系统的敏捷性和可维护性要求日益增长,微服务架构应运而生,并迅速成为业界的新宠。微服务架构通过将大型复杂系统拆分成一组小型、自治的服务来提高系统的弹性和可伸缩性。然而,要实现一个高效的微服务架构并非易事,需要遵循一系列最佳实践和策略。以下是构建高效微服务架构的五大关键策略: 服务划分原则服务划分是微服务架构的基础。...
构建高效可靠的微服务架构:后端开发的新范式
在信息技术快速发展的今天,软件系统的规模和复杂度不断攀升。企业为了满足不断变化的市场需求和用户期望,需要快速迭代产品并持续交付价值。然而,传统的单体应用由于其紧密耦合的特性,难以应对这样的挑战。在这种背景下,微服务架构成为了后端开发领域的一项创新技术,它通过将一个大型的单体应用拆分成一组小型、独立的服务来提高系统...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
架构更多构建相关
金融级分布式架构
SOFAStack™(Scalable Open Financial Architecture Stack)是一套用于快速构建金融级分布式架构的中间件,也是在金融场景里锤炼出来的最佳实践。
+关注